Nha Trang (/ˌnɑːˈtʃæŋ/, Vietnamese pronunciation: [ɲaː˧ ʈʂaːŋ˧]) is a coastal city and capital of Khánh Hòa Province, on the South Central Coast of Vietnam. It is bounded on the north by Ninh Hoà district, on the south by Cam Ranh town and on the west by Diên Khánh District. The city has about 392,000 inhabitants, a number that is projected to increase to 560,000 by 2015 and 630,000 inhabitants by 2025.
